Output 18e76c314c7d3840e376f181678853a51491967c504a2bd66450ce9a7abb38c0:0

value
17888894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1509dfafcb3c2e50442df51f5bca40c90c68e5 OP_EQUAL
address
3Ma8S9YrWS4gtYvW4JNvo56dhXD4RrjmVt
transaction
18e76c314c7d3840e376f181678853a51491967c504a2bd66450ce9a7abb38c0
spent
true